For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 226 students in Janesville, IA.
The top ranked public high school in Janesville, IA is Janesville Junior-senior High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Janesville, IA public high school have an average math proficiency score of 76% (versus the Iowa public high school average of 65%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 71% statewide average). High schools in Janesville have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Iowa public high schools.
Janesville, IA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 80%, which is less than the Iowa average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Janesville Junior-senior High School, with ≥80%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Iowa or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public high school average of 27% (majority Hispanic).
